Location: Dorset - Homebased (with travel across the South Coast)

Salary: £22,697 per annum + allowances

Contract: 21 hours per week - Permanent (3 Days: Monday + 2 other days)

Closing Date: 4 August 2027

As a Senior Supervising Social Worker, with TACT you’ll work closely with foster carers and social work colleagues to deliver high‑quality, trauma‑informed support and improve outcomes for children and young people.

Key Responsibilities

  • To supervise and support a diverse range of foster carers and children.
  • Ensure children are safe, well cared for and achieve positive outcomes consistent in line with TACT policies.
  • Undertake Form F assessments where needed.
  • Facilitate regular support groups and learning opportunities, which will include the delivery of training.
  • Develop the service and support colleagues.
  • Record and update CHARMS and all other appropriate central/social work systems.
  • Participate in Out of Hours Service.
